Masterbatch Deccicant Moisture Remover
Whatsapp Order
Masterbatch Deccicant Moisture Remover is a high-performance additive designed to control and reduce moisture content in polymer processing. It incorporates desiccant materials within a masterbatch carrier to efficiently absorb moisture during extrusion, injection molding, and other plastic manufacturing processes. By minimizing moisture-related defects such as hydrolysis, bubbles, and degradation, this masterbatch enhances the quality and durability of plastic products. It is compatible with various thermoplastics and offers improved processing stability and surface finish.

Primary UsesÂ
- Moisture Control in Polymer Processing
- Absorbs moisture during melting and molding to prevent hydrolysis and degradation of polymers like PET, Nylon, and Polycarbonate.
- Reduces defects such as bubbles, voids, and poor surface finish caused by residual moisture.
- Quality Enhancement
- Improves mechanical properties and clarity of molded parts by maintaining polymer integrity.
- Enhances dimensional stability and reduces warpage during cooling.
Secondary UsesÂ
- Recycling Applications
- Used in recycled polymer blends to manage moisture content and improve processability.
- Specialty Polymer Production
- Applied in specialty resin processing where moisture sensitivity is critical.
PRODUCT KEY FEATURES
- Basic Identification Attributes
- Chemical Name (IUPAC): Polymer masterbatch with incorporated desiccant compounds (e.g., silica gel, molecular sieves)
- Common/Trade Name: Masterbatch Desiccant Moisture Remover
- CAS Number: Not applicable (mixture)
- HS Code: 3916.90.90
- Synonyms: Moisture control masterbatch; desiccant masterbatch; moisture scavenger additive
- Physical & Chemical Properties
- Physical State: Solid granules or pellets
- Color & Odor: Typically white or off-white; odorless
- Density: Varies by polymer carrier, generally 1.0 – 1.4 g/cm³
- Solubility: Insoluble in water; desiccant component absorbs moisture from the polymer melt
- Safety & Hazard Attributes
- GHS Classification: Not classified as hazardous under normal handling
- Toxicity: Low toxicity; inert polymer base with non-toxic desiccant materials
- Exposure Limits: Follow standard dust precautions during handling
- Storage & Handling Attributes
- Storage Conditions: Store in a dry, cool environment to prevent premature moisture absorption
- Container Type: Supplied in sealed bags or containers to maintain dryness
- Shelf Life: Typically 12 months if stored properly
- Handling Precautions: Avoid dust generation; use PPE if handling large quantities
- Regulatory & Compliance Attributes
- Complies with plastic additive standards and safety regulations
- Free from heavy metals and harmful substances according to regulatory requirements
- Environmental & Health Impact
- Biodegradability: Not biodegradable but inert and stable
- Ecotoxicity: Minimal environmental impact if disposed of properly
- Bioaccumulation: Not applicable
- Carcinogenicity/Mutagenicity: Not classified as hazardous

Dioctyl Phthalate (DOP)
Dioctyl Phthalate (DOP), also known as di(2-ethylhexyl) phthalate (DEHP), is a widely used plasticizer primarily added to polyvinyl chloride (PVC) and other polymers to enhance flexibility, durability, and workability. It is a clear, colorless, oily liquid with a slight ester odor. Due to its excellent compatibility with many polymers and long-lasting plasticizing effects, DOP is one of the most common phthalate plasticizers used in industries such as construction, automotive, packaging, and medical devices. It also serves as a solvent and dispersant in various chemical processes.

Hydroxyethyl Cellulose
Hydroxyethyl Cellulose , marketed under brand names such as Natrosol, is a non-ionic, water-soluble polymer derived from cellulose by reacting alkali cellulose with ethylene oxide. It appears as a white to off-white, free-flowing powder with excellent thickening, binding, and film-forming properties. HEC is widely used as a rheology modifier and stabilizer due to its high water retention, solubility, and compatibility with a broad range of ingredients. It is valued in many industries including cosmetics, pharmaceuticals, paints, adhesives, and personal care products.

Latex
Latex is a natural or synthetic colloidal dispersion of polymer microparticles in an aqueous medium. Natural latex is harvested from rubber trees (Hevea brasiliensis) and appears as a milky fluid rich in rubber particles suspended in water. Synthetic latexes are produced from various monomers such as styrene-butadiene or acrylics. Latex exhibits excellent elasticity, flexibility, and adhesive properties. It is widely used in manufacturing gloves, balloons, coatings, adhesives, paints, and various molded products. Its film-forming ability, water resistance, and durability make it a versatile material across industries.
Lead Octoate Drum
Lead Octoate Drum is a viscous liquid solution containing 30% lead octoate, a metal soap derived from lead and 2-ethylhexanoic acid (also known as octanoic acid). It is primarily used as a drying agent (drier) in paints, varnishes, and coatings to accelerate the curing process by promoting oxidation and polymerization of drying oils. This product is widely employed in industrial coatings to improve drying times, hardness, and durability of surface films. Packaged typically in 250kg drums, Lead Octoate 30% is handled with care due to the toxic nature of lead compounds.
